Descripción de la sesión

For many young people, a love for nature can manifest in recreation outside, a set of hobbies, or volunteering. Fewer among us have the opportunity to build a whole career around nature. In this session, young conservationists representing IUCN Member organizations will reflect on their early-career experiences, drawing insights on the factors that have supported their entry into the field and recommendations for improving access for others to launch into similar nature-based jobs. In particular, participants will speak to the ways in which IUCN membership facilitates career growth.
